What are the main nutrients found in mixed nuts?

Mixed nuts boast a diverse array of nutrients, varying slightly depending on the specific nut blend. However, some common nutritional powerhouses consistently appear:

  • Healthy Fats: Mixed nuts are exceptionally rich in monounsaturated and polyunsaturated fats, the "good" fats that contribute to heart health. These fats help lower LDL ("bad") cholesterol and raise HDL ("good") cholesterol, reducing the risk of cardiovascular disease.

  • Protein: Nuts are a fantastic source of plant-based protein, crucial for building and repairing tissues, supporting muscle growth, and maintaining overall bodily functions.

  • Fiber: The fiber content in mixed nuts aids in digestion, promotes regularity, and contributes to feelings of fullness, potentially aiding in weight management.

  • Vitamins and Minerals: Mixed nuts are a treasure trove of essential vitamins and minerals, including vitamin E (a powerful antioxidant), magnesium (important for muscle and nerve function), and selenium (a trace mineral with antioxidant properties).

Are mixed nuts good for weight loss?

This is a question that often arises, and the answer is nuanced. While nuts are calorie-dense, their high fiber and protein content contribute to satiety, meaning you feel fuller for longer. This can potentially help manage weight by reducing overall calorie intake. However, moderation is key. A small handful as a snack can be beneficial, but overconsumption can negate the weight management benefits.

What are the health benefits of eating mixed nuts?

The health benefits extend far beyond weight management:

  • Improved Heart Health: The healthy fats and other nutrients in mixed nuts contribute to a lower risk of heart disease, stroke, and other cardiovascular problems.

  • Reduced Risk of Type 2 Diabetes: Studies suggest that regular consumption of nuts may improve insulin sensitivity and reduce the risk of developing type 2 diabetes.

  • Improved Brain Function: Certain nuts, like walnuts, are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which are essential for brain health and cognitive function.

  • Enhanced Antioxidant Protection: The vitamins and minerals in mixed nuts offer powerful antioxidant protection, fighting free radicals and reducing the risk of chronic diseases.

What is the best way to eat mixed nuts?

The best way to enjoy mixed nuts is as part of a balanced diet. A small handful (about a quarter cup) a day is a great way to incorporate their nutritional benefits without overdoing it on calories. Avoid excessively salted or overly sweetened varieties, opting for unsalted or lightly salted options to maintain a healthy approach.

Are there any side effects of eating mixed nuts?

While generally safe, some individuals may experience allergic reactions to certain nuts. Those with nut allergies should avoid mixed nuts altogether. Additionally, consuming large quantities can lead to digestive upset in some people due to the high fat content. Moderation remains the key to reaping the benefits while avoiding any potential negative effects.
